1. Personalization with Role-Based Dashboards
Tailor the user experience by creating role-specific dashboards that display relevant data and actions. Implement dynamic user profiles and permission settings so:
- IT admins receive real-time maintenance alerts and inventory analytics.
- Employees view equipment check-out history and instant request options.
- Managers access usage reports and approval workflows.

2. Interactive, Visual Asset Tracking with Real-Time Updates
Utilize data visualization techniques like infographics, heatmaps, and animated icons to represent equipment status and stock levels. Features can include:
- Interactive floor plans: Clickable office maps letting users locate equipment instantly.
- Real-time updates and push notifications: Alert stakeholders of low inventory or maintenance needs immediately.

3. Streamlined Request and Approval Workflow Design
Design smart forms using auto-fill and adaptive questions to minimize effort when requesting equipment. Visualize multi-step approval processes with clear status indicators and estimated wait times to reduce friction and anxiety. Integrate in-app messaging to facilitate seamless communication during approvals, eliminating reliance on external emails or calls.

4. Augmented Reality (AR) for Efficient Equipment Identification
Incorporate AR scanning to link physical objects to digital records by pointing mobile cameras at QR codes or RFID tags. Use AR-guided navigation overlays to direct users precisely to equipment locations within large office spaces or storage areas. Incorporate AR-based training to visually demonstrate equipment use or troubleshooting steps.

8. Reliable Offline Mode with Data Syncing
Implement offline access allowing users to view inventory and submit requests without internet connectivity. Use automatic syncing to update changes once online, with conflict resolution workflows ensuring accurate data.
